Sponsors get behind 6 in 6 marathon runners

Jason Easy, Katie Ball & Ben Lowe are running 6 marathons in 6 days for The Light Fund.

With the clocking ticking down to the start of their epic challenge on April 18, a number of sponsors have come on board to back the 6 in 6 marathon challenge by an industry trio.

Roy Lowe & Sons’ Ben Lowe and Katie Ball and Jason Easy from BBC Worldwide will be tackling the feat to raise money for The Light Fund. The first five marathons will be ran along the Grand Union Canal, which goes from Birmingham to London, with the sixth to be the London Marathon on Sunday, April 23.

Kit for the challenge is kindly being supplied by Scimitar Sports, while Fabric Flavours, TDP, Titan Merchandise, DNC and the Sock Mine are also backing the trio.

Meanwhile, training continues apace (pun intended) with Ben and Katie notching up an impressive 20-mile run at the recent Thames Riverside 20 along the River Thames (main picture) – Katie having already put in a sterling performance the previous day at the Victoria Park half marathon.

Jason, meanwhile, decamped to slightly sunnier climes, fitting in the training while he was in Barbados – at least, he told us he trained; we’re not entirely convinced looking at the picture below.
